On April 22, Jacobs secured a key role in a joint venture with GHD and WSP to design 5 new underground stations for the Sydney Metro West project. Under the Stations Package West, Jacobs will provide integrated engineering design services for the stations at Westmead, North Strathfield, Burwood North, Five Dock, and The Bays.
This appointment reinforces the firm’s position as a global leader in transportation infrastructure, following its successful completion of previous tunnel and station excavation packages for the same metro line in late 2025. Executive VP Sinead Giblin highlighted that this project builds on Jacobs’ track record of supporting transformative rail investments that drive regional economic growth and housing development.
The firm’s design approach for these stations centers on high-performance infrastructure, specifically targeting a 6-Star Green Star As Built rating to meet rigorous sustainability and environmental standards. This project adds to a global portfolio of mass transit solutions that includes major programs in New York, the UK, and Malaysia. Ranked as the No. 2 firm in Transportation by Engineering News-Record, Jacobs Solutions Inc. (NYSE:J) continues to expand its footprint in Australia’s largest transport project through this collaboration with lead contractor Gamuda.
Jacobs Solutions Inc. (NYSE:J) provides consulting, design, engineering, and infrastructure delivery services for several industries.
